Set in 1870s Montana, the story begins just before the execution of Isaac Broadway. He tasks his estranged son, Henry, with a perilous mission: to murder the man responsible for falsely accusing him. Driven by a desire to honor his father's request, Henry journeys to the isolated town of Trinity. However, he soon finds himself caught in a web of unexpected circumstances and must confront a series of challenges.

Does The Unholy Trinity have end credit scenes?

No!

The Unholy Trinity does not have end credit scenes. You can leave when the credits roll.

Echo Score

The Movie Echo Score

47

The Unholy Trinity exhibits uneven qualities that result in a middling reception. Many critics found the performances by Samuel L. Jackson and Pierce Brosnan to elevate the material, even as they noted the familiar plot and generic production. Audiences praised the cinematography and soundtrack but also pointed to pacing issues and contrived story beats. The film offers occasional entertainment but ultimately leaves a limited lasting impact.

Full Plot Summary and Ending Explained for The Unholy Trinity

In the rugged and unforgiving frontier town of Trinity, Montana, a young man named Henry Broadway witnesses a tragic event that will shape his future. His father, Isaac, is hanged before his eyes, passionately claiming his innocence and insisting that he was falsely accused by a corrupt sheriff, Gabriel Dove. Despite their estranged relationship, Henry, who has always been somewhat gullible, believes his father’s story and feels compelled to honor his dying wish: to clear Isaac’s name and pursue justice.

When Henry arrives in Trinity, he immediately seeks out the current sheriff, Gabriel Dove, a man trying to maintain order amidst the chaos of the town’s troubled history. Gabriel gently informs Henry that the infamous sheriff Isaac blamed, Saul Butler, has long been dead, and warns him about the dangerous legacy that surrounds Isaac’s story. The townsfolk hold Isaac as a villain and see Saul as a hero, making Henry’s quest to uncover the truth seem all the more complicated. Rumors circulate that Saul Butler was killed by a Blackfoot woman known as Running Cub, a rumor that prompts one of the townspeople, Gideon, to demand that Sheriff Dove investigate her whereabouts. Gabriel manages to find Running Cub but, convinced of her innocence, advises her to stay clear of the town’s conflicts.

As Henry tries to settle in, he stays at the local saloon, where tensions quickly escalate. That night, a dispute over a prostitute named Julia ignites into violence. A miner named Asa shoots Julia, and in retaliation, Henry shoots Asa. The altercation prompts Asa’s brother, Red, to pursue Henry, but he is swiftly killed by St. Christopher, a priest and former slave. St. Christopher reveals that he was once Isaac’s partner during the Civil War, and that Isaac had stolen a significant amount of gold from the South. Isaac had double-crossed Christopher and now is believed to have hidden his share of the treasure under his family home. Christopher hired a man called Jacob, a “stage actor,” to extract a confession from Isaac, but Jacob arrived with additional gunmen and ended up taking Henry hostage.

Following this, Gabriel, under pressure from Gideon and the furious Red, goes after Running Cub. Meanwhile, Jacob and his men attack Gabriel and Henry, but with help from St. Christopher and Running Cub, they manage to kill Jacob and his men. Gabriel confirms that Arthur’s hunt for Isaac’s hidden gold is heating up, and that Henry’s house, once owned by Isaac, has been searched before without success. Gideon and his posse, desperate to find the treasure and exact revenge, implement a plan to find Running Cub, targeting her for interrogation.

In Gabriel’s absence, Christopher visits Isaac’s house in search of the gold and has a tense confrontation with his wife, Sarah. Henry intervenes, explaining that the treasure is missing. Gabriel’s posse then confronts Running Cub once more, but Gabriel arrives and reveals a surprising truth: he killed Saul Butler to save a child, and not for the reasons everyone believed. This revelation sparks a shootout at Gabriel’s house, resulting in most of the posse being killed, including Gideon’s son, and leaving Running Cub injured. Gabriel and Running Cub later escape on horseback to Gabriel’s house, where Running Cub shares memories of how she knew him as a boy and taught him to ride.

As tensions escalate, Gideon and Christopher rally the townsfolk for revenge, aiming to seize the gold and settle old scores. Gabriel advises Sarah to escape with Julia’s orphaned daughter, Mabel, but she chooses to stay and defend her home. Henry also refuses to leave and fights alongside them. During the chaos, Asa’s brothers capture and torturously interrogate Henry, but his sister intervenes, ending their violence. Most of the attackers are killed in the gunfire, including Gideon. Meanwhile, Christopher, believing the gold is hidden beneath the town’s church, kills the town’s barman and the preacher before digging for the treasure himself.

Henry and Gabriel confront Christopher, who tries to fight them for the gold. Henry offers Christopher a chance to take his share and leave peacefully, but Christopher refuses and is shot dead by Gabriel. In the aftermath, Henry, having undergone a transformation, disperses his father’s ashes in a moment of closure. As he prepares to leave Trinity, he accepts his inheritance of Isaac’s house but chooses to let Gabriel keep it, recognizing the life Gabriel has built there with his family. Gabriel, seeing how much Henry has grown, insists that he stay and officially grants him a sheriff’s badge, symbolizing Henry’s new role and the justice he seeks to uphold.

Throughout this story of betrayal, retribution, and redemption, Samuel L. Jackson as Gabriel Dove and other characters navigate a landscape filled with danger and moral ambiguity, ultimately finding that sometimes, justice comes at a high price but can also lead to unexpected peace.
